Warning Signs You Need Ice Dam Water Damage Restoration

Catching the signs of ice dam water damage early is key to preventing more extensive and costly repairs. Ignoring these indicators can lead to serious structural issues and mold problems. Keep an eye out for these common clues around your property.

Water Stains on Ceilings or Walls

These are often the most obvious signs. If you see discolored patches, especially in the upper areas of rooms or near exterior walls, it means water has penetrated your ceiling or wall materials. This is a clear signal of water intrusion.

Dripping Water from Light Fixtures or Vents

When water backs up under shingles and penetrates your roof deck, it can find its way down through your insulation and drywall. Dripping from fixtures or vents means water is actively making its way into your living space. This requires immediate professional intervention.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

A persistent damp or musty smell, particularly in attics or upper rooms, is a strong indicator of hidden moisture and potential mold growth. This smell can develop even before visible water damage appears. It’s a sign you need to address hidden moisture.

Peeling or Bubbling Paint/Wallpaper

Moisture trapped behind your paint or wallpaper can cause it to lose its adhesion, leading to bubbling or peeling. This is especially common near window frames or where ceilings meet walls. It’s a sign of moisture compromising finishes.

Ice Build-up on Roof Edges or Gutters

While not direct water damage inside, significant ice build-up around the eaves and in gutters is the primary cause of ice dams. If you see this, be vigilant for the other signs, as water is likely pooling and seeking entry. This is your early warning sign.

Sagging Ceiling or Damp Insulation

If you notice your ceiling appearing to sag, or if attic insulation feels heavy and damp, it’s a sign that water has saturated it. This can weaken the ceiling structure and reduce insulation effectiveness. It’s critical to inspect attic moisture.

Ice Dam Water Damage Restoration v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Detecting a small, fresh water stain on a ceiling panel. Yes, monitor closely. Yes, if it reappears or grows. DIY checks help you learn your home, but professionals have the tools to detect hidden moisture.
Removing visible ice from gutters. Maybe, with extreme caution and proper safety gear. Yes, if ice is extensive or roof is steep. Safety is paramount; falls are dangerous. Professionals have the right equipment.
Drying a small, damp spot on a carpet. Yes, with fans and dehumidifiers. Yes, if the spot is large or keeps returning. Small spots are manageable, but widespread dampness needs professional equipment to prevent mold.
Identifying the source of a persistent musty odor in the attic. No. Yes. Attics can be hazardous, and finding hidden leaks requires specialized tools and expertise.
Repairing minor drywall damage from a small leak. Yes, if you’re handy. Yes, if damage is extensive or structural. Cosmetic repairs are often DIY-friendly, but structural damage needs expert assessment.
Drying out a saturated subfloor or structural beams. No. Yes. This level of water saturation requires industrial drying equipment and expertise to prevent long-term rot and mold.

Ice Dam Water Damage Restoration Cost In Eloy, AZ

The cost of ice dam water damage restoration in Eloy, AZ can vary significantly. Factors like the extent of water damage, the size of the affected area, and the complexity of the necessary repairs all play a role. These figures are general estimates and not a guarantee of final cost.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Initial Inspection and Damage Assessment $300 – $800 The complexity of the damage and the number of affected areas.
Water Extraction $500 – $2,500 The volume of water and the size of the affected rooms or spaces.
Controlled Drying (Dehumidification & Air Movers) $700 – $3,000+ The duration of drying needed, based on saturation levels and building materials.
Mold Prevention Treatments $400 – $1,200 The size of the area treated and the type of antimicrobial solutions used.
Minor Drywall/Insulation Repair $500 – $2,000 The amount of material needing replacement and the labor involved.
Full Structural Drying and Restoration $2,000 – $10,000+ This is for severe cases involving extensive structural drying and rebuilding.

Can I prevent ice dams from forming in the first place?

Yes, prevention is key. Ensuring your attic is properly insulated and ventilated is crucial to maintaining an even roof temperature, which prevents melting and refreezing.
